Shear thinning is a phenomenon characteristic of some non-Newtonian fluids in which the fluid viscosity decreases with increasing shear stress.In shear thinning independent forces act on the molecule. It is the result microscale structural rearrangements within the fluid, such as a change in the way red blood cells move about in blood hexagonally packed structures that slide over each other more easily.Best examole is tamato sauce in which viscosity decreases with increased stress.It is an example of non-Newtonian fluid.In non-Newtonian fluids, viscosity can change when under force to either more liquid or more solid., the viscosity (the gradual deformation by shear or tensile stresses) of non-Newtonian fluids is dependent on shear rate or shear rate history. Some non-Newtonian fluids with shear-independent viscosity, however, still exhibit normal stress-differences or other non-Newtonian behavior.
